Abstract
Techniques are provided for near real-time anomaly event detection and classification with trend change detection for smart water grid operation management. In the first phase, a trend change is detected in each of one or more sensors by comparing new sensor data of a sensor with a historical trend pattern of the same sensor. In the second phase, and after the trend changes are detected, a valid event evaluation time window can be determined based on combining and analyzing the detected trend changes for flow and pressure sensors, e.g., at least one flow sensor and at least one pressure sensor from the same supply zone of the smart water grid. The valid event evaluation time window can be used with anomaly events that are detected in near-real time to classify the anomaly events in near-real time as valid, e.g., true anomaly events, or invalid, e.g., false alarms.
